Roof covering Misconception: All Leaks Are Evident



Unlike popular belief, not all leaks in your roofing system are promptly recognizable. While just click the next post may manifest as noticeable water spots on your ceiling or wall surfaces, others can be much sneakier, creating damage with no noticeable indications. These concealed leakages typically occur around locations like the smokeshaft, skylights, or in the attic where water can permeate in slowly over time, leading to rot, mold and mildew, and structural problems.

To detect these elusive leakages, it's important to carry out routine inspections of your roof covering, especially after severe weather. Look for missing out on or damaged shingles, fractured blinking, or clogged rain gutters that can add to water seepage.

Furthermore, focus on any type of musty smells, drooping ceilings, or peeling off paint, as these can be indicators of covert leakages.

Roofing Misconception: A New Roof Addresses All Problems



Despite typical belief, getting a brand-new roofing system doesn't constantly guarantee that all your roofing troubles will be fixed. While a new roofing system can certainly attend to lots of concerns and offer a clean slate for your home, it may not be the utmost option to all underlying issues.

Some troubles such as improper setup, air flow issues, or concealed architectural damages might persist despite having a brand-new roofing in position.

It's important to comprehend that a new roofing system is simply one piece of the puzzle when it comes to maintaining a healthy and balanced roofing system. Correct diagnosis of any existing issues, comprehensive assessment, and attending to underlying concerns are similarly crucial. Overlooking these actions can lead to recurring problems despite a brand-new roof overhead.

Roof Covering Misconception: Roofing System Inspections Are Unnecessary



Numerous home owners neglect the relevance of normal roof covering inspections, assuming they're unnecessary. Nevertheless, this is a typical roofing misconception that can bring about expensive consequences.

Roofing examinations are vital for discovering possible concerns at an early stage, avoiding major damage in the long run. By scheduling regular inspections, you can recognize minor issues like loose roof shingles, cracked seals, or stopped up rain gutters before they rise right into bigger, much more pricey issues.

Professional roof covering assessments additionally play a crucial role in keeping your roof's service warranty. Many roof warranties call for normal examinations to stay valid. Neglecting these inspections might nullify your warranty, leaving you responsible for any type of future repair work or substitutes out of pocket.
